OFFICIAL STATE VEGETABLES
State Vegetable Adopted as Year
Alabama      
Alaska      
Arizona      
Arkansas South Arkansas Vine Ripe Tomato Official state fruit and official state vegetable 1987
California      
Colorado      
Connecticut      
Delaware      
Florida      
Georgia Vidalia sweet onion Official Georgia state vegetable 1990
Hawaii      
Idaho Potato State vegetable 2002
Illinois      
Indiana      
Iowa      
Kansas      
Kentucky      
Louisiana Sweet potato Official state vegetable 2003
Louisiana Creole tomato Official state vegetable plant 2003
Maine      
Maryland      
Massachusetts      
Michigan      
Minnesota      
Mississippi      
Missouri      
Montana      
Nebraska      
Nevada      
New Hampshire      
New Jersey      
New Mexico Chile & Pinto Bean (frijol) Official state vegetables 1965
New York      
North Carolina Sweet potato Official vegetable 1995
North Dakota      
Ohio      
Oklahoma Watermelon Official vegetable 2007
Oregon      
Pennsylvania      
Rhode Island      
South Carolina      
South Dakota      
Tennessee      
Texas Sweet onion State vegetable 1997
Utah Spanish sweet onion State vegetable 2002
Vermont      
Virginia      
Washington Walla Walla sweet onion Official vegetable 2007
West Virginia      
Wisconsin      
Wyoming
